Output e707c05e4169028cdebd832d6eb77624ae8a32a4f34baae94ac2459f3a7a83ef:3

value
960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ba61e8558a405eded62fedb007e1c22b43b2330f OP_EQUAL
address
3JgWtxf5858kPMCU1JNZ88dGJimB3X4X1q
transaction
e707c05e4169028cdebd832d6eb77624ae8a32a4f34baae94ac2459f3a7a83ef
spent
true